Asynchronous channel for displaying user interface elements

A system is for use in printing data on a printer (13,13a). A client (11,110) interfaces with an applications program (112) that has a print capability. A print server (12) in communication with the client (11,110) controls a printing of data communicated to the print server (12) by the client (11,1...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Hauptverfasser: SHIPLEY KENTON A, IVANOV LAZAR I, BARTHOLOMEW PAUL D, FENG JIN
Format: Patent
Sprache:eng
Schlagworte:
Online-Zugang:Volltext bestellen
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
Beschreibung
Zusammenfassung:A system is for use in printing data on a printer (13,13a). A client (11,110) interfaces with an applications program (112) that has a print capability. A print server (12) in communication with the client (11,110) controls a printing of data communicated to the print server (12) by the client (11,110). A user interface manager (130) communicates with the print server (12) by an asynchronous bi-directional communications channel (132) between the print server (12) and the client (11,110). The user interface manager (130) responds to a user interface message sent from the print server (12) to display information to a user in a flexible custom manner. One exemplary system includes a user display. The message sent to the client user interface manager (130) by the server (12) is a language neutral message that is interpreted by the user interface manager (130) and converted to another representation for presentation to the user on the user display. When used in a printing environment, i.e. where a client print spooler (114) and a server print server (12) do the printing, the language neutral message is converted at the client (11,110) by the user interface manager (130) into a message or display suitable for a user.